The siesta is beneficial

Is it recommended to nap? The answer is simple, AEPap indicates yes. From this organism it is indicated that there are several studies that remember the importance that the smallest ones have this moment of break after meals. Among the positive results of this activity include:

- Help to better assimilate the learning made during the day.

- Help save information in short-term memory. Leave the mind clear to learn new things by favoring the performance of activities such as homework.

- Encourages abstract learning and logical reasoning.

- The nap reduces hyperactivity, eliminates tension and fatigue accumulated during the morning.


- The rest that it provides helps to face better the activities of the afternoon. Reactive and sharpens the mind.

- Improves the child's behavior and well-being.

AEPap also banishes the myth that napping is causing insomnia in the little ones. In fact, this organism emphasizes that not betting on this activity supposes a smaller rest in the children which entails a greater irritability that prevents falling asleep correctly.

Tips for the right nap

Once the benefits of napping for the little ones are known, there are some tips to get the most out of this time of day:

- Sleep routines. As with the night rest, betting on sleep routines in the nap will help the child to enter a state of relaxation at certain times of the day favoring this practice.


- Maintain the same schedule. Following in the wake of the dream routine, betting on the same nap schedule every day will allow the creation of this habit of long-term rest.

- Know the habits of day care centers. Some children's schools have specific nap schedules for the youngest ones, knowing them will help the parents to maintain these routines on the days that the children do not go to these centers.

- Do not force if you do not want to. If the child does not want to nap, it is a bad idea to force him to do so. The decision of the smallest must be respected.

- No more than half an hour of nap. While the nap is not guilty of insomnia, too many hours of this practice can make it difficult to rest during the night. Half an hour should be the maximum time children dedicate to this activity.
